Soffits and the fascia, which are situated under roof overhangs, are designed to protect the home against humidity infiltration, let air circulate through the attic, deter rodents and other pests out, and enhance the roofline. But like any part of a home, they wear out and require repairs over time.

The cost of the installation of soffit and fascia or repair can vary based on the size and type of material used. Generally, a roofer charges between $6 and $20 per linear foot, plus the cost of the materials. The cost can vary depending on the location and experience of the contractor. The cost of your project may increase if the project is in an inaccessible location. Further repairs or issues may also add to the total cost of your project.
Choosing the right material for your soffit and fascia is essential to their purpose and long-term durability. Wood is a popular choice because it's beautiful and durable however, it can be damaged by moisture. Other options include vinyl and aluminum. Both are extremely lightweight and water-resistant, but vinyl is slightly more expensive than wood.

Soffit and fascia play a essential role in any roofing system. They serve two roles to protect the rafters from water, which could lead to structural damage, and they give a finished appearance to the roofline. These seemingly minor elements could be crucial to the health of your home and safety, therefore it is essential to engage an expert when they need to be repaired.
The first step in the repair of the fascia and soffit procedure is to conduct an inspection. This involves revealing details regarding the issue and determining the extent of the damage. The company then sends a qualified professional to the property to assess the situation. This visit is crucial as the contractor will detect any issues that could be causing problems and correct them as soon as they are discovered.
After the inspection is completed The professional will fix or replace the damaged parts of soffit or fascia. This includes removing old materials and repairing any damage, as well as sealing and painting the fascia or soffit in order to stop further damage. In some instances, damaged sections will have to be completely replaced.
Professionals will also ensure that the soffit and fascia are properly ventilated. This will help keep the attic cool and dry, which can reduce your heating and cooling costs. It will also prevent moisture from seeping into the rafters, which could cause wood rot and mold growth.

The soffit is situated beneath the roof eaves and is an essential part of the home's structure. It's responsible to vent hot air out of the attic and keeping rainwater out of the foundation, and preventing rodents and pests from building nests. It's also critical for gutter attachment and for providing a finished look at the eaves. If the soffit is damaged it could cause water damage and mold growth in your attic, which could be costly to repair.
A fascia is a board that runs along a roof's edge and is put in following the soffit. It's typically comprised of wood or a wood-alternative and it's often vented to help with air circulation in the attic. It's also essential for supporting gutters and creating the foundation for the installation of shingles. A damaged fascia and soffit repair can cause water damage to the eaves, as well as the rest of the house.
Soffits and fascia can be damaged by a variety of factors including the climate and the quality of their installation. A well-maintained soffit or fascia will last longer, and they will help to preserve the strength of your roof's rafters. Regular maintenance includes cleaning the fascia, repainting (if required), and fixing any damage as quickly as possible.
